This project helps 3D artists, game developers, or architects realistically place virtual objects into real-world images or scenes. It takes a photograph of an indoor environment as input and generates an illumination map, which describes the lighting conditions of that scene. This allows the user to render virtual objects so they appear naturally lit and integrated into the image, matching the real environment's light.
